What is Osteopathy? Osteopathy is a system of diagnosis and treatment for a wide range of medical conditions. It works with the structure and function of the body, and is based on the principle that the well-being of an individual depends on the skeleton, muscles, ligaments and connective tissues functioning smoothly together’ Osteopaths use various techniques, physical manipulation, stretching and massage to increase the mobility of joints, to relieve muscle tension, to enhance the blood and nerve supply to tissues, and to help your body’s own healing mechanisms. They may also provide advice on posture and exercise to aid recovery, promote health and prevent symptoms recurring. How can Osteopathy help you? An Osteopath’s main tool is their hands, used to identify abnormalities in the structure and function of a body, and to assess areas of weakness, tenderness, restriction or strain. By physical examination and assessing the movement and functioning of the body, your osteopath can diagnose and discuss with you the most appropriate treatment plan, estimating the likely number of sessions needed to treat your condition effectively. By using Osteopathic techniques as a form of treatment it can work with your body’s ability to heal itself and help to restore the natural equilibrium. Treatment can range from relaxing and releasing muscle tension and stretching tight muscle tissue. Gentle massage and rhythmic movements applied to restricted joints in the spine
